Weightlifter Renu Bala Chanu wins ninth gold for India in CWG

By ANI
Wednesday, October 6, 2010

NEW DELHI - After Omkar Singh won the 50metre Pistol final shooting gold with a score of 653.6 points, Renu Bala Chanu won the ninth gold for India on the third day of the XIXth Commonwealth Games today with a win in 58kg weightlifting.

Earlier today, World Champion Gagan Narang beat Olympian gold winner Abhinav Bindra to win the gold in the 10 m air rifles (Singles).

Narang scored 703.6 points, while Bindra scored 698 points.

Anisa Sayyed also bagged gold medal in the individual 25m pistols event today, while Rahi Sarnobat won the silver.

Sarnobat and Sayyed together had got the gold medal in the 25m pairs event on Tuesday. (ANI)
